Output 2960531022931ece6a96caad0f488baaaf4aa43e9b266cf74c096277afd9bb68:1

value
9935453
script pubkey
OP_0 OP_PUSHBYTES_20 41c8d310ecd3c23f39c5a822ff16c18121387862
address
bc1qg8ydxy8v60pr7ww94q3079kpsysns7rzut3vrs
transaction
2960531022931ece6a96caad0f488baaaf4aa43e9b266cf74c096277afd9bb68
spent
true